
letra de sea drift, op. 69 - samuel coleridge-taylor
see where she stands, on the wet sea-sands
looking across the water:
wild is the night, but wilder still
the face of the fisher’s daughter
what does she there, in the lightning’s glare
what does she there, i wonder?
what dread demon drags her forth
in the night and wind and thunder?
is it the ghost that haunts this coast? —
the cruel waves mount higher
and the beacon pierces the stormy dark
with its javelin of fire
beyond the light of the beacon bright
a merchantman is tacking;
the ho-rs- wind whistling through the shrouds
and the brittle topmasts cracking
the sea it moans over dead men’s bones
the sea it foams in anger;
the curlews swoop through the resonant air
with a warning cry of danger
the star-fish clings to the sea-weed’s rings
in a vague, dumb sense of peril;
and the spray, with its phantom-fingers, grasps
at the mullein dry and sterile
o, who is she that stands by the sea
in the lightning’s glare, undaunted? —
seems this now like the coast of h-ll
by one white spirit haunted!
the night drags by; and the breakers die
along the ragged ledges;
the robin stirs in his drenchéd nest
the hawth-rn blooms on the hedges
in shimmering lines, through the dripping pines
the stealthy morn advances;
and the heavy sea-fog straggles back
before those bristling lances
still she stands on the wet sea-sands;
the morning breaks above her
and the corpse of a sailor gleams on the rocks —
what if it were her lover?
